1. Biography of Lex Luger
Lex Luger, born Lawrence Wendell Pfohl on June 2, 1958, in Buffalo, New York, is a former professional wrestler and football player. Luger developed an interest in sports from an early age, excelling in football during his high school years. After graduating, he attended the University of South Carolina, where he played as a linebacker.

2. Early Career
After college, Luger briefly pursued a career in professional football, playing for the Green Bay Packers. However, his true passion lay in wrestling. He trained under the guidance of legendary wrestler Hiro Matsuda and made his wrestling debut in 1985. Luger quickly gained popularity due to his impressive physique and athleticism, earning him opportunities in various wrestling promotions.
